Mamane Barka

Mamane Barka

Mamane Barka of Niger is a celebrated musician with desert blues at his heart. Mamane is famously known as the ‘Lone Master of the Biram’, an enormous boat shaped 5-stringed harp sacred to the Boudouma people of Lake Chad.
